Vývojář Pythonu
Rozvíjejte svou kariéru jako Vývojář Pythonu.
Realizace softwarových řešení v Pythonu, přeměna nápadů na funkční aplikace
Build an expert view of theVývojář Pythonu role
Realizuje softwarová řešení pomocí Pythonu, přeměňuje nápady na funkční aplikace. Navrhuje, programuje a udržuje robustní backendové systémy a skripty. Spolupracuje s týmy na dodávání škálovatelných a efektivních produktů založených na Pythonu.
Overview
Kariéry v vývoji a inženýrství
Realizace softwarových řešení v Pythonu, přeměna nápadů na funkční aplikace
Success indicators
What employers expect
- Vyvíjí API a mikroslužby zpracovávající více než 10 000 denních požadavků.
- Optimalizuje kód pro výkon, snižuje dobu načítání o 40 %.
- Integruje databáze jako PostgreSQL, zajišťuje integritu dat napříč systémy.
- Automatizuje testovací procesy, dosahuje 90% pokrytí kódu.
- Řeší problémy v produkci, vyřizuje 95 % do 4 hodin.
- Přispívá k open-source projektům, získává více než 500 hvězdiček na GitHubu.
A step-by-step journey to becominga standout Plánujte svůj růst v roli Vývojář Pythonu
Získejte základní znalosti
Ovladněte syntaxi Pythonu, datové struktury a principy objektově orientovaného programování prostřednictvím strukturovaných kurzů a praktických projektů.
Získejte praktické zkušenosti
Přispívejte k osobním nebo open-source projektům s důrazem na aplikace z reálného světa, jako je extrakce dat z webu nebo automatizace.
Sledujte formální vzdělání
Získejte bakalářský titul v informatice nebo certifikát z kodovacího bootcampu s důrazem na metodologie vývoje softwaru.
Navazujte kontakty a stažte se
Připojte se k komunitám vývojářů, účastněte se neformálních setkání a zajistěte si stáž pro budování profesionální sítě.
Certifikujte se a vytvořte portfolio
Získejte relevantní certifikace a představte portfolio na GitHubu s více než 5 nasazenými projekty.
Skills that make recruiters say “yes”
Layer these strengths in your resume, portfolio, and interviews to signal readiness.
Build your learning stack
Learning pathways
Obvykle vyžaduje bakalářský titul v informatice; bootcampy a sebevzdělávání urychlují vstup do rolí vývojáře.
- Bakalářský titul v informatice nebo příbuzném oboru (3 roky).
- Kodovací bootcamp zaměřený na Python (3–6 měsíců).
- Online kurzy na Coursera nebo edX z programování v Pythonu.
- Sebevzdělávání prostřednictvím bezplatných zdrojů jako freeCodeCamp a oficiální dokumentace.
- Diplom v oboru vývoje softwaru (2 roky).
- Magisterský titul v inženýrství softwaru pro pokročilé pozice (2 roky).
Certifications that stand out
Tools recruiters expect
Tell your story confidently online and in person
Use these prompts to polish your positioning and stay composed under interview pressure.
LinkedIn headline ideas
Představte své znalosti Pythonu prostřednictvím odkazů na projekty, doporučení a příspěvků, abyste zdůraznili dopad spolupráce.
LinkedIn About summary
Zkušený vývojář Pythonu s vášní pro přeměnu složitých nápadů na robustní a škálovatelné aplikace. Zdatný v backendovém vývoji, návrhu API a nasazování v cloudu. Spolupracoval na projektech obsluhujících více než 100 000 uživatelů, optimalizoval výkon a zajistil bezproblémové integrace. Toužím přispět k inovativním týmům.
Tips to optimize LinkedIn
- Zahrňte odkazy na více než 3 projekty v Pythonu na GitHubu do profilu.
- Doporučte dovednosti jako Django a AWS, abyste přilákali rekrutery.
- Zveřejňujte týdenní aktualizace o trendech v Pythonu nebo úryvcích kódu.
- Navazujte kontakt s více než 50 softwarovými inženýry měsíčně pro networking.
- Přizpůsobte shrnutí kvantifikovatelnými úspěchy, např. 'Snížení latence API o 50 %'.
- Používejte klíčová slova v nadpisu pro optimalizaci ATS.
Keywords to feature
Master your interview responses
Prepare concise, impact-driven stories that spotlight your wins and decision-making.
Vysvětlete, jak byste optimalizovali pomalou funkci v Pythonu zpracovávající velká data.
Popište budování RESTful API s Djingem, včetně autentizace.
Jak řešíte konflikty v řízení verzí v týmovém workflow s Git?
Projděte ladění problému s nasazením v produkci na AWS.
Jaké návrhové vzory jste použili v projektech v Pythonu a proč?
Jak zajišťujete kvalitu kódu v prostředí spolupráce?
Diskutujte o integraci API třetí strany do aplikace v Pythonu.
Vysvětlete strategie unit testování pomocí pytest pro webovou aplikaci.
Design the day-to-day you want
Vyvažuje programovací sprinty s ranními týmovými stand-upy v agilním prostředí; běžné jsou možnosti práce na dálku nebo hybridní model s 40hodinovým týdnem zaměřeným na iterativní dodávky.
Prioritizujte úkoly pomocí Jira, abyste splnili termíny sprintů.
Plánujte denní revize kódu pro posílení týmové spolupráce.
Dělejte krátké přestávky během ladění, aby se udržela koncentrace.
Využívejte párové programování pro složité problémy.
Sledujte rovnováhu práce a soukromého života s flexibilními hodinami a nástroji pro práci na dálku.
Účastněte se týdenních retrospektiv pro zlepšení procesů.
Map short- and long-term wins
Postup od junior programování k vedení projektů v Pythonu, dosažení expertizy v fullstack vývoji a cloudové architektuře pro významné dodávky softwaru.
- Dokončete 2–3 projekty v Pythonu a nasaďte je do produkce do 6 měsíců.
- Získejte certifikaci PCAP a přispějte k open-source repozitáři.
- Ovladněte framework Django, vytvořte API obsluhující více než 1 000 požadavků.
- Spolupracujte na týmovém projektu, snižte chyby o 20 %.
- Navštivte 2 technologická setkání, zajistěte si mentora.
- Optimalizujte osobní portfolio kódu pro zlepšení výkonu o 50 %.
- Vedejte tým vývoje v Pythonu, dodávejte enterprise aplikace.
- Dosažte role senior inženýra se specializací na AWS.
- Přispějte k hlavním open-source knihovnám v Pythonu.
- Přejděte do role tech lead, mentorujte juniory v best practices.
- Spusťte startup nebo vedlejší projekt založený na Pythonu.
- Studujte magisterský titul v AI s aplikací znalostí Pythonu.